I would say Bioshock should give someone a decent idea of how well their system will perform with regards to UT3 and performance. It must be stated though that Bioshock's developers did a lot of work and uses a number of their own rendering and engine aspects. The water for instance is entirely their own work. Also the game first started development on the Unreal Engine 2.5, then transitioned over to UT3. It should still provide a good clue.
My own experience with my system (Core 2 Duo E6300 @ 2.8Ghz, 2GB RAM, X1950 Pro 256MB) is Bioshock performs very well at 1680x1050 and near max settings.
